What will I learn?
This Feature Engineering Course teaches you how to transform raw pump sensor data into effective predictive features. You will cover data validation, timestamp alignment, handling missing values, detecting outliers, and creating pipelines that prevent leakage. Develop time-based, aggregated, and categorical features, use encoding, selection, and dimensionality reduction techniques, and perform practical diagnostics to enhance 7-day failure prediction performance swiftly and dependably.

Develop skills
- Time-series features: construct rolling, trend, and seasonal indicators for failures.
- Categorical encodings: implement one-hot, target, and frequency methods appropriately.
- Sensor data preparation: clean, align, and resample noisy pump telemetry efficiently.
- Leakage-safe pipelines: develop time-aware cross-validation, imputation, and feature processes.
- Feature validation: apply SHAP, mutual information, and drift assessments to maintain model reliability.
